
Ricotta and spinach quiche is such a heartwarming dish that’s just perfect for a family brunch or a cozy dinner at home. It’s a delightful blend of creamy ricotta and nutritious spinach, all encased in a buttery crust. This quiche is not only delicious but also a great way to sneak in some veggies for the little ones. It’s a versatile dish that can be enjoyed warm or cold, making it a wonderful make-ahead meal for busy days.
This quiche pairs wonderfully with a fresh green salad, perhaps with some tangy vinaigrette to balance the richness of the quiche. A light tomato soup would also complement this dish well. For a more indulgent meal, you might consider serving it with crispy roasted potatoes or a selection of fresh fruit on the side. And don’t forget a nice cup of tea or a glass of your favorite light white wine to round out the meal!
